More about the book
The revised and expanded edition delves into Stephen King's significant influence on popular culture, exploring his themes, characters, and storytelling techniques. Dr. Michael R. Collings provides a comprehensive analysis of King's work and its lasting effects on literature and media, highlighting the author's unique contributions to the horror genre and beyond. This edition offers fresh insights and a deeper understanding of King's cultural phenomenon.
